اليَومَ أُحِلَّ لَكُمُ الطَّيِّبٰتُ ۖ وَطَعامُ الَّذينَ أوتُوا الكِتٰبَ حِلٌّ لَكُم وَطَعامُكُم حِلٌّ لَهُم ۖ وَالمُحصَنٰتُ مِنَ المُؤمِنٰتِ وَالمُحصَنٰتُ مِنَ الَّذينَ أوتُوا الكِتٰبَ مِن قَبلِكُم إِذا ءاتَيتُموهُنَّ أُجورَهُنَّ مُحصِنينَ غَيرَ مُسٰفِحينَ وَلا مُتَّخِذى أَخدانٍ ۗ وَمَن يَكفُر بِالإيمٰنِ فَقَد حَبِطَ عَمَلُهُ وَهُوَ فِى الءاخِرَةِ مِنَ الخٰسِرينَ٥

This day [all] good foods have been made lawful, and the food of those who were given the Scripture is lawful for you and your food is lawful for them. And [lawful in marriage are] chaste women from among the believers and chaste women from among those who were given the Scripture before you, when you have given them their due compensation, desiring chastity, not unlawful sexual intercourse or taking [secret] lovers. And whoever denies the faith - his work has become worthless, and he, in the Hereafter, will be among the losers.

Surah Al-Ma'idah 5

يٰأَيُّهَا الَّذينَ ءامَنوا لا تُحَرِّموا طَيِّبٰتِ ما أَحَلَّ اللَّهُ لَكُم وَلا تَعتَدوا ۚ إِنَّ اللَّهَ لا يُحِبُّ المُعتَدينَ٨٧

O you who have believed, do not prohibit the good things which Allah has made lawful to you and do not transgress. Indeed, Allah does not like transgressors.

Surah Al-Ma'idah 87
Quran

وَكُلوا مِمّا رَزَقَكُمُ اللَّهُ حَلٰلًا طَيِّبًا ۚ وَاتَّقُوا اللَّهَ الَّذى أَنتُم بِهِ مُؤمِنونَ٨٨

And eat of what Allah has provided for you [which is] lawful and good. And fear Allah, in whom you are believers.

Surah Al-Ma'idah 88

أُحِلَّ لَكُم صَيدُ البَحرِ وَطَعامُهُ مَتٰعًا لَكُم وَلِلسَّيّارَةِ ۖ وَحُرِّمَ عَلَيكُم صَيدُ البَرِّ ما دُمتُم حُرُمًا ۗ وَاتَّقُوا اللَّهَ الَّذى إِلَيهِ تُحشَرونَ٩٦

Lawful to you is game from the sea and its food as provision for you and the travelers, but forbidden to you is game from the land as long as you are in the state of ihram. And fear Allah to whom you will be gathered.

Surah Al-Ma'idah 96
